Finding great fantasy novels is like uncovering treasure, and I’ve mapped out the best places to dig.

Goodreads remains a powerhouse for tailored recommendations. Their annual Choice Awards and user-generated lists are perfect for discovering books like 'The Name of the Wind' or 'The Priory of the Orange Tree.' I also swear by YouTube channels like 'Merphy Napier'—her deep dives into world-building and character analysis led me to masterpieces like 'The Broken Earth' trilogy.

For niche tastes, specialized blogs like 'Fantasy Book Review' offer in-depth critiques. Podcasts like 'The Legendarium' dissect themes and tropes, making it easier to pick your next read. Local bookstores often host fantasy book clubs, too; I joined one last year and stumbled upon 'The Jasmine Throne,' which blew my mind.

Lastly, platforms like StoryGraph let you filter by mood or pacing, which is clutch when you’re craving a specific vibe.

I love sharing my finds with fellow book lovers. Goodreads is my go-to spot for recommendations because of its personalized suggestions and active community. I also frequent r/Fantasy on Reddit, where fans discuss everything from epic sagas like 'The Stormlight Archive' to hidden gems like 'The Lies of Locke Lamora.' BookTok on TikTok is another goldmine, with creators like @fantasybookqueen sharing passionate reviews. For curated lists, I check out Tor.com's monthly roundups—they always highlight something fresh. Don’t overlook Discord servers like The Fantasy Inn, where readers swap recs in real time. If you want a mix of classics and new releases, Book Riot’s fantasy section never disappoints.

I rely on a mix of social media and niche forums. TikTok’s #BookTok community is surprisingly savvy—I discovered 'The Invisible Life of Addie LaRue' through a viral video. Twitter threads from authors like N.K. Jemisin often spotlight underrated works, like 'The Traitor Baru Cormorant.'

I also love browsing themed lists on websites like Barnes & Noble’s SFF blog, which introduced me to 'The Fifth Season.' For interactive recs, Discord groups like 'Fantasy Fling' are stellar; members once convinced me to try 'The Poppy War,' and it became an instant favorite.

Don’t forget libraries! Many now offer personalized recommendation services—mine suggested 'The City of Brass,' and it was a perfect match. If you prefer audio, podcasts like 'SFF Yeah!' highlight genre standouts with infectious enthusiasm.

Where can I find good book easy read fantasy novels online?

5 答案2025-07-02 17:10:04
I’ve spent years hunting down the best places to find easy reads online. My absolute go-to is Kindle Unlimited—it’s a goldmine for light fantasy like 'Legends & Lattes' by Travis Baldree or 'Howl’s Moving Castle' by Diana Wynne Jones. The subscription pays for itself if you read even a couple of books a month. Another spot I love is Project Gutenberg, which offers free classics like 'The Princess and the Goblin' by George MacDonald. For newer releases, Scribd is fantastic because it has a mix of audiobooks and ebooks, including cozy fantasy gems like 'The House in the Cerulean Sea' by TJ Klune. Don’t overlook your local library’s digital apps like Libby or Hoopla, either—they often have great fantasy picks without the waitlists.

Can you recommend a good book to read romance with fantasy?

4 答案2025-08-14 11:32:21
I can't help but recommend 'A Court of Thorns and Roses' by Sarah J. Maas. It's a mesmerizing tale that weaves together faerie lore, passionate romance, and high-stakes adventure. The chemistry between Feyre and Tamlin is electric, and the world-building is absolutely immersive. Another favorite is 'The Invisible Life of Addie LaRue' by V.E. Schwab, where a girl makes a Faustian bargain to live forever but is cursed to be forgotten by everyone she meets—until one day, someone remembers her. The romance is bittersweet and hauntingly beautiful, set against a backdrop of centuries and continents. For those who enjoy a darker, more intricate plot, 'Uprooted' by Naomi Novik offers a gripping romance entwined with Slavic folklore and a sentient, malevolent forest. The dynamic between Agnieszka and the Dragon is both fiery and tender, making it a standout in the genre.
